Mission

The Gastrointestinal and Liver Association of the Americas (GALA) was formed in 2013 to unite health care providers across the Americas treating patients with chronic liver and gastrointestinal diseases. GALA serves as an educational nonprofit organization to disseminate critical information on treatment and diagnostic modalities, ultimately aimed at improving patient outcomes.

The MIP Score and it's methodology is purely used as a way to visualize how a nonprofits public financial data compares against others. It doesn't reflect the unique circumstances and impact that a nonprofit has.The MIP Score should never be used to say one charity is better than another.
